Identifying the parties liable

Truck accidents often involve multiple parties, including car manufacturers and trucking companies. If their products weren't maintained in a proper manner, these parties could be held responsible for the incident. If the road conditions were hazardous or there were no signs or functioning lights or warnings, the state or federal government could be held accountable. In addition, truck drivers could be accountable for their own carelessness. An attorney who specializes in these kinds of accidents will help you identify the parties at fault.

Once you've identified liable parties, you'll need to contact their insurance companies. Many will try to determine who's at fault. The insurance companies are interested in establishing the responsibility, as these wrecks cost a lot of money and damage. They will do everything to minimize the risk. Identifying liable parties is crucial in determining the amount of money you'll get following a truck accident.

You may file a negligence claim against the trucking firm if the truck driver is responsible for the accident. Employers are typically responsible for the actions of their employees. However there are exceptions. For instance, the company could be held accountable for accidental death if a driver was under the influence of drugs or alcohol or if a truck driver was fatigued or distracted at the time of the accident. A trucking business could also be held responsible when the cargo was not properly loaded or not properly secured.

Documenting an accident is crucial. Make photographs, collect documents, and also collect medical records. Medical bills and other documents are essential pieces of evidence that will help your case. Also, dial 911 to obtain an official police report.

Cost

The cost of hiring a truck crash lawyer is contingent on a variety of factors, including the type of case, the circumstances surrounding the accident, and the nature of the legal proceedings needed to obtain compensation. The average attorney's fee is about 30-40% of total settlement. In some cases the fees could be even more expensive. You should discuss the fee with your lawyer before signing any contract.

Although you can find plenty of information on truck accidents on the internet However, the advice of a lawyer will be based on your own unique situation. An attorney will review your case to ensure you get the best outcome. An attorney can also assist you to get a better understanding of the process for creating your case. For example, hiring an expert to build models for reconstruction of accidents is a significant amount of money, but it can help strengthen your case.

It is essential to know whether a lawyer works on a basis of a contingent fee or an hourly rate when choosing the right lawyer. The latter is more convenient as you don’t have to be concerned about paying the lawyer's fees if the case doesn't succeed. Some lawyers will not accept truck accident cases on contingency and may instead charge an hourly rate.

You should find an attorney who is well-versed in commercial vehicle laws. Laws governing accidents involving trucks are more complicated than those applicable to cars. Trucks may have to be subject to regular medical exams and drug tests. An attorney who is familiar with the rules and regulations that govern commercial vehicles is essential.
